The People's Friend - Issue 7890
Fabulous fiction with seven short stories, including family drama 'A Snapshot Of Malta' by Jacqui Cooper, and 'Love Letters', Alison Carter’s perceptive story inspired by 'Romeo And Juliet'. Willie Shand climbs Mount Blair on the border of Angus to savour the views, Bill Gibb chats to actress Jenny Seagrove about her charity, Mane Chance, and Dianne Boardman explores the lasting appeal of Georgette Heyer... Plus more stories, serials, health, gardening, knitting, recipes, travel, and much more inside.
